What Even IS an AV Control System?

The “Brain” Behind Your Tech

At its core, an AV control system is the central nervous system of your office technology. Think of it as the “brain” that orchestrates all your audio-visual equipment – from projectors and displays to microphones, speakers, and video conferencing gear. But it doesn’t stop there. The truly sophisticated systems extend their reach to encompass lighting and even climate control, creating a fully integrated and harmonious environment. But what are its superpowers, its core functionalities that elevate it beyond mere remote control?

  • One Remote to Rule Them All: Imagine the liberation of banishing the clutter of multiple remotes, each dedicated to a single, often obscure, function. A unified interface places the power to command your entire AV kingdom at your fingertips.
  • Set It & Forget It: Automation is the key. The system anticipates your needs, prepping the room automatically based on your schedule.
  • Plays Nicely with Others: A truly intelligent system integrates seamlessly with existing platforms such as Zoom, Microsoft Teams, room booking systems, and even smart lighting.
  • Your Tech, On Demand: Remote access and monitoring empower IT to diagnose and resolve issues proactively, often before you even realize there’s a problem.
  • Tailored to You: Customization and programming allow for personalized setups, adapting the technology to your unique workflows and preferences.
  • Go Green, Save Green: Energy efficiency features automatically power down unused equipment, reducing your carbon footprint and lowering your energy bills.

From Hand Cranks to Touchscreens: A Whirlwind History of AV Control

To truly appreciate the sophistication of modern AV control systems, it’s essential to understand the winding road that led us here.

  • The “Good Old Days” (aka The Manual Mayhem Era – Pre-1980s): Imagine a time when presentations were elaborate productions, requiring teams of technicians to physically operate magic lanterns, phonographs, and film projectors. Each device demanded individual attention, a symphony of manual adjustments. With the rise of individual remotes chaos ensued with many plastic clickers lying around.
  • The Digital Dawn (1990s – Early 2000s): The advent of computers marked a turning point. Companies like Crestron and AMX emerged, pioneering automated control solutions for the masses. Early touch panels, though clunky by today’s standards, offered a tantalizing glimpse into a button-free future.
  • The Connected Revolution (2000s – Today): The introduction of the iPad ushered in an era where mobile devices became universal remotes. AV over IP emerged, allowing signals to travel across the internet’s infrastructure, increasing flexibility and scalability.

The Elephant in the Room: Controversies and Challenges

However, the path to AV control nirvana is not without its obstacles.

  • Proprietary vs. Open Standards: The Tech Turf War: The debate between proprietary and open standards systems continues. Proprietary systems offer simplicity and a single point of contact but risk vendor lock-in and limited choices. Open standards provide ultimate flexibility, future-proofing, and potential cost savings.
  • Integration Headaches: “Why Won’t My Devices Talk?!” Compatibility issues between different brands and older technologies can lead to integration challenges.
  • Security Shenanigans: Is Your AV a Cyber Weak Link? Security vulnerabilities, such as unsecured microphones and cameras, remote access risks, and outdated software, pose significant threats. Treat your AV system like critical IT infrastructure, implementing strong passwords, regular updates, encryption, and network segmentation.

The Crystal Ball: What’s Next for AV Control?

Looking ahead, the future of AV control promises even greater sophistication and integration.

  • AI Takes the Wheel (and the Microphone!): AI-powered systems will learn user preferences, adjust settings automatically, and even predict maintenance needs before problems arise.
  • IoT Everywhere: Your Smart Building’s New Best Friend: AV systems will integrate seamlessly with other building systems, such as lighting, HVAC, and security, creating truly “smart” environments.
  • Voice Control: Say Goodbye to Buttons Forever!: Natural language commands and context-aware AI will enable users to control AV systems with their voices, enhancing accessibility and convenience.
  • The Cloud Power-Up: Managing your entire AV ecosystem from the cloud will simplify updates and maintenance.
